Muscle memory is a powerful thing, especially when you’ve spent six years in the same colors. 🏎️💨😅 Throwing it back to the 2013 Malaysian Grand Prix—only Lewis Hamilton’s second race with Mercedes. After years of stopping in the same spot, instinct took over. On lap 8, Lewis pulled into the pit lane, saw the familiar silver and white of the McLaren crew, and instinctively pulled right into his old pit box! 🏁👀 The McLaren mechanics—who were actually waiting for Jenson Button—stood there stunned for a split second before waving him through. Lewis realized the blunder almost immediately and accelerated a few doors down to the correct Mercedes garage. Even his then-girlfriend Nicole Scherzinger couldn’t help but laugh from the back of the garage. After the race, Lewis laughed it off, admitting, “I just did a Jenson!”—referencing a similar mistake Jenson Button made in 2011. In F1: The Movie, there’s a brief nightclub scene where a woman approaches Joshua Pearce (Damson Idris). When he says he’s an F1 driver, she skips asking about his team and instead asks if he can introduce her to Carlos Sainz. The moment is played for humor, highlighting Sainz’s real-life popularity beyond the sport. It works as light comic relief, though some viewers felt it leaned into a cliché about how fans engage with Formula 1. The “Osama Bin Russell” meme is one of those internet jokes where Formula 1 fans mix dark historical references with motorsport humor — creating a completely absurd but viral nickname for George Russell. The meme plays on the similarity between the name Osama bin Laden and Russell’s surname, turning it into a ridiculous wordplay: “Osama Bin Russell.” The joke usually appears when Russell pulls off something sneaky, chaotic, or unexpectedly aggressive during a race — like a bold overtake, a strategic move, or a moment where he benefits from on-track drama. Fans exaggerate the situation by acting as if Russell is some kind of mastermind “plotting” moves on the grid, and the nickname becomes the punchline. Of course, it’s purely internet satire and not meant to reference real-world events seriously — just the kind of over-the-top humor that Formula 1 Twitter and meme pages thrive on. The meme also highlights Russell’s reputation in modern F1: extremely smart, opportunistic, and always ready to capitalize when others make mistakes. Whether it’s perfectly timing a pit stop, making a daring pass, or quietly climbing the order while chaos unfolds, Russell often ends up benefiting from situations in ways fans jokingly describe as “calculated.” In the fast-moving world of motorsport memes, “Osama Bin Russell” became popular because it combines three things fans love: unexpected wordplay, dramatic race moments, and the internet’s habit of turning drivers into exaggerated characters.
